issues
search
josefs
/
Gradualizer
A Gradual type system for Erlang
MIT License
613
stars
35
forks
source link
issues
Newest
Newest
Most commented
Recently updated
Oldest
Least commented
Least recently updated
Refine bound vars with guards
#523
erszcz
opened
1 year ago
0
Solve constraints in type_check_list_op_in/3
#522
erszcz
opened
1 year ago
0
Fix all remaining self-check errors
#521
erszcz
closed
1 year ago
3
New known problem: refine bound vars with guards
#520
erszcz
closed
1 year ago
1
Solve constraints in unary_op_arg_type/2
#519
erszcz
opened
1 year ago
0
Solve constraints on vars bound in each clause of an inline fun
#518
erszcz
opened
1 year ago
0
Don't discard annotations in instantiate/2
#517
erszcz
closed
1 year ago
1
Test fixes for #500
#516
erszcz
closed
1 year ago
0
Adding suppressions to accept type-defensive code?
#515
Olivier-Boudeville
closed
1 year ago
7
Fix intersection-typed function calls with union-typed arguments
#514
erszcz
closed
1 year ago
14
Treat boolean() as refinable
#513
xxdavid
closed
1 year ago
20
Join var binds in add_type_pat_union/3 with least upper bound not greatest lower bound
#512
erszcz
closed
1 year ago
15
Make the solver results deterministic
#511
erszcz
closed
1 year ago
0
Make sure the constraint solver results are deterministic
#510
erszcz
closed
1 year ago
0
Type refinement of map keys and values
#509
zuiderkwast
closed
1 year ago
4
test: adds known map key type refinement issue
#508
javiergarea
closed
1 year ago
0
Multiple map key patterns raise an unexpected type check error
#507
javiergarea
closed
1 year ago
4
Drop invalid lists:filtermap/2 known problem
#506
erszcz
closed
1 year ago
1
Fix exhaustiveness checking for union types
#505
xxdavid
closed
1 year ago
3
Fix yet more self check errors
#504
erszcz
closed
1 year ago
1
Constraint solver limitation known problem test and a workaround
#503
erszcz
closed
1 year ago
0
Fix more self check errors
#502
erszcz
closed
1 year ago
0
No errors are flagged for guarded function clauses
#501
duncanatt
opened
1 year ago
3
Fix handling of module_info for arities > 1
#500
xxdavid
closed
1 year ago
23
Require all functions in src/typechecker.erl to have specs
#499
erszcz
closed
1 year ago
1
Fix specs introduced with Mod:module_info/1,2 support
#498
erszcz
closed
1 year ago
1
rebar3 case clause error
#497
mpope9
opened
1 year ago
2
Add support for module_info functions
#496
xxdavid
closed
1 year ago
4
Add a Hex badge to README
#495
erszcz
closed
1 year ago
0
Improve unsupported expression (e.g. maybe) handling
#494
erszcz
opened
1 year ago
1
Release 0.2.0
#493
erszcz
closed
1 year ago
2
Maybe expr unsupported 1
#492
erszcz
closed
1 year ago
0
Print inferred argument types on call_intersect error
#491
erszcz
closed
1 year ago
2
Solved: every record is a tuple, but not every tuple is a record
#490
tsloughter
opened
1 year ago
4
Add known problem for unsupported maybe expression
#489
ferd
closed
1 year ago
4
Override filename specs
#487
erszcz
closed
2 years ago
2
Move test from test/known_problems/should_pass/intersection.erl to test/should_pass/intersection_pass.erl
#486
erszcz
closed
2 years ago
0
Expand erlang.++ function specs
#485
luk-pau-es
closed
2 years ago
4
Error message needs more info: `The type of the function _____, called on line ___ doesn't match the surrounding calling context.`
#484
japhib
closed
1 year ago
4
exclude option in rebar.config does not work
#483
jesperes
opened
2 years ago
11
fix GitHub reference in rebar3 example README
#482
kivra-fabber
closed
2 years ago
2
Override the spec of erlang:error/3 too
#481
erszcz
closed
2 years ago
0
Fix erlang:error/2 spec
#478
erszcz
closed
2 years ago
0
Exhaustiveness check does not merge unions
#477
xxdavid
closed
1 year ago
1
`error/2` and `error/3` false positive (treating `none` atom as an invalid argument)
#476
xxdavid
closed
2 years ago
11
add xref ignores to header file defining ::/:::
#475
tsloughter
closed
2 years ago
0
Undefined function `module_info/0`
#473
tsloughter
closed
1 year ago
2
module type resolution or non_neg_integer a subtype of Integer
#472
tsloughter
closed
2 years ago
1
Exported module type not recognized as same type
#471
tsloughter
opened
2 years ago
1
support excluding modules in gradualizer:type_check_file
#470
tsloughter
closed
2 years ago
0
Previous
Next